Great place to stay for winter ski vaca. Quiet. Walkable to Snowflake lift even with ski boots on. Heated garage is great for parking car and leaving skis and boots. Plenty of room for our family of five. We had an overnight guest who used the sofa bed in the living room. Great time!
Was overall very pleased with our stay. Clean, spacious and extremely convenient location. Apparently we chose the busiest week of the year to visit Breckenridge. Was walking distance to Main Street. Was unaware of health issues due to altitude, next time we will pre-medicate. Mattressâs were a little hard for our taste. Would choose this location again.
100 yards or so to Snowflake lift. Less than a 10 minute walk to the village. Garage was great, and fit our large SUV (although others in the same building couldnât fit their trucks). Condo fit our family well, although wasnât the most luxurious place weâve stayed (dated furniture, older carpeting, wood paneling). Washer and dryer were great. Would stay here again.
The unit was really clean, well stocked, all appliances and humidifier in working order. Light switches, garage door openers, etc. labeled so it was really clear on how to operate things. The garage, kept in a state of low heat well above freeing, had a well laid-out area for boot/gear removal and gear storage. There was a clearly laid out way to maintain outside gear and boots and enable changing to inside shoes without tracking mud into the unit. Nice stay. Roughly three blocks somewhat uphill walk to get to the Snowflake lift/trailhead where there was an equipment rental location (Charter Sports). Roughly half-mile walk to Main St. Bus stop nearby.

The question is, would I stay there again and the answer is no. The positive is the property was clean and was a great location to the hills and town. However, the property is much more tired than what is portrayed in the pictures. The fireplace (which heats the ground floor) never worked (on a day of a blizzard), we had to get a spare heater from the mgt company (which blew a fuse), the kitchen door fell off, the chairs were broken, I repaired a toilet which didnât flush, the water is warm at best for showers, the carpet looks at least 10+ years old, etc. I base my decision as someone who rents myself and have stayed at other Breck properties. There are better options for the price. Also, there is no pool in the winter (itâs seasonal), unlike the pictures which were portrayed.

We've stayed at Breckinridge properties for the past 8 years, but not at this one before. Winterpoint 22 had hits and misses. The location is perfect. Easy walking to downtown. Unit was very clean and plenty of towels and spacious for two to four people. Heating the family room area was a challenge as the thermostat next to the sliding glass door turned on the gas fireplace only twice, though we repeatedly set it higher than the current temp., which stayed around 66-68. 2nd bedroom bed is very hard, so if you like a hard bed, choose the one next to the alley. The bed pillows in that room need to be replaced. They are old and flat. Finally, the hot water was barely enough for two people. We don't dawdle in the shower, but my wife shaved her legs and I ended up finishing with a cold shower when I went in. That shouldn't happen with two people. Manager allowed a late check out, which was nice.
